Schematics

Timing Diagram Creator: Revolutionizing Visual Communication

In the world of technology and engineering, accurately conveying the temporal relationships between different signals and events is paramount. This is where a powerful tool known as the Timing Diagram Creator comes into play. Whether you're designing complex digital circuits, troubleshooting software interactions, or explaining intricate sequences, a Timing Diagram Creator simplifies the process of visualizing these crucial time-based dynamics.

Understanding the Power of a Timing Diagram Creator

A Timing Diagram Creator is essentially a specialized software application or online platform that allows users to graphically represent the timing of events or signals within a system. These diagrams are indispensable for understanding how different components of a system interact over time. They are used across a wide spectrum of fields, from electrical engineering and computer science to telecommunications and even project management. The primary function of a Timing Diagram Creator is to translate abstract timing specifications into easily digestible visual representations.

How are they used? Let's look at some common applications:

  • Digital Logic Design: Engineers use Timing Diagram Creators to illustrate the behavior of logic gates, flip-flops, and microprocessors. They can see when signals rise, fall, and remain stable, helping to identify potential timing conflicts or race conditions.
  • Software Development: Programmers can use these tools to visualize the sequence of function calls, data transfers, and thread synchronization, making it easier to debug complex multi-threaded applications.
  • Protocol Analysis: When working with communication protocols, a Timing Diagram Creator helps in understanding the precise timing of data packets, acknowledgments, and control signals, which is vital for ensuring reliable data transmission.

The ability to quickly generate and modify these diagrams makes the Timing Diagram Creator an invaluable asset. Here's a breakdown of common elements you'll find:

  1. Signal Lines: Represent individual signals that change state over time.
  2. Timing Markers: Indicate specific points in time, such as the rising edge or falling edge of a signal.
  3. States: Depict the value of a signal (high, low, or transitioning) at different points in time.
Element Purpose
Clock Signal Synchronizes events in a system.
Data Signal Carries information between components.
Control Signal Manages the flow of operations.

The importance of clear and accurate timing diagrams cannot be overstated; they prevent costly errors and accelerate the development process.

If you're looking to gain a deeper understanding of your system's temporal behavior or need to communicate complex timing relationships effectively, we highly recommend exploring the capabilities of a Timing Diagram Creator today. Its intuitive interface and powerful visualization features will undoubtedly enhance your design and debugging workflows.

See also: